The Role
As an Agency Registered Mental Health Nurse, you'll provide high-quality, recovery-focused care across a range of mental health settings, including acute inpatient units, PICU, rehabilitation services, forensic services, CAMHS, and community mental health environments.
You'll work as part of multidisciplinary teams to assess, plan and deliver person-centred care, supporting individuals experiencing a wide range of mental health conditions.
Key Responsibilities
Deliver safe, high-quality nursing care in line with individual care plans
Carry out mental health assessments and contribute to care planning
Administer medication and treatments in accordance with NMC guidelines
Monitor and assess patients' mental and physical wellbeing, escalating concerns where appropriate
Build therapeutic relationships and promote recovery-focused care
Manage challenging behaviours using positive behaviour support and de-escalation techniques
Maintain accurate clinical records and documentation
Work collaboratively with multidisciplinary teams to deliver the best possible outcomes
Ensure compliance with NMC standards, safeguarding procedures and mental health legislation
What We're Looking For
Current NMC registration as a Registered Mental Health Nurse (RMN) - essential
A minimum of 6 months recent UK experience working as an RMN
Experience working within mental health services
Excellent assessment, communication and clinical decision-making skills
A compassionate, resilient and professional approach
Flexibility to work a variety of shifts, including days, nights and weekends
The ability to travel within Darlington and the surrounding areas using your own transport or public transport
